Abstract
A rotary drive linear rod displacement pump includes a pump housing supporting a plurality of radially spaced linear rod displacement pump segments. A rotor supporting a plurality of roller cam followers is rotatably coupled to the pump segments and is driven by a source of rotary power. As the rotor is driven, the cam followers articulate the pump segments.

10 . The rotary drive linear rod displacement pump set forth in claim 9 wherein said displacement pump segments each include:
a fluid chamber formed in said housing;
a pump rod, coupled to a pump plunger, supported for movement between a withdrawn position and an inserted position relative to said fluid chamber; and a discharge output; and
a pump rod spring urging said pump rod and its coupled pump plunger toward said withdrawn position,
said pump plunger moving said pump rod from said withdrawn position to said inserted position as said cam followers contact said pump plunger during rotation of said rotor.
11 . The rotary drive linear rod displacement pump set forth in claim 10 wherein said valve segments each include:
a valve rod supported within said pump housing coupled to a valve plunger;
a valve closure moveable between an open condition allowing fluid to flow into said fluid chamber and a closed condition preventing fluid flow from said fluid chamber; and
a valve rod spring urging said valve rod and its coupled valve plunger toward said open condition;
said valve plunger moving said valve rod from said open condition to said closed condition as said cam followers contact said valve plunger during rotation of said rotor.
